Who We Are

Rising Edge Group is an electrical contracting company founded in 2002, specialization in high-voltage electrical solutions that power critical infrastructure across North America. With operations in both Canada and the United States, we partner with clients across the electrical utilities, renewable energy, and industrial sectors to design, build, andmaintainthe critical infrastructure systems communities and industries rely on.

What You'll Do

Reporting to the Procurement Manager, the Purchaser role focuses on supporting the purchasing needs for materials, tools, equipment, and services for projects and operational scopes. The Purchaser is responsible for ensuring that the correct material, equipment, and services are sourced for the projects, considering risk profile considerations, and commercial alignment with company and project requirements.
